Third Party Data Annual Submission

Third Party Data Annual Submission

4 April 2023 – A reminder that the SARS Third Party Data Annual Submissions opened on 1 April 2024 and will close on 31 May 2024. Third parties must submit accurate and complete data for the entire period of 1 March 2023 – 29 February 2024.

Third Parties (banks, medical schemes, fund administrators, among others.) must, by law, send data to SARS via a return. They must include information such as:

  • savings account interest,
  • medical scheme contributions,
  • withholding tax on interest,
  • dividends tax,
  • IT3 data submissions: IT3(b), IT3(c), IT3(e), IT3(s),
  • medical scheme contributions, and insurance payments.

Third Party data providers can submit data to SARS using these three electronic options:

  1. eFiling (via a data submission form with a limited volume)
  2. Connect: Direct® (Unlimited)
  3. Secured File Gateway [HTTPS] (for files smaller than 10MB)

To ensure a successful submission to use and activate these channels, you must be registered with eFiling.
